UK 2025 Wedding Industry Report

Even though the study of 700+ couples mainly captured information revolving around wedding venues in the UK, I feel it is valuable information for wedding pros in all facets of weddings worldwide.
Key Takeaways
1. Understanding Your Audience
94% of engaged couples are Gen Z and Millennials, with the majority aged 25-34.
Most respondents identify as heterosexual brides (94%).
54% of couples are engaged for 6 months or less, making early marketing crucial.
78% plan to marry in the next 1-2 years, so securing bookings early is key.
2. Budget & Financial Considerations
65% say the cost of living has impacted their budget, making value-for-money offerings critical.
The percentage of couples spending over £20K has risen by 6%, but budget-conscious couples are still prevalent.
Many prioritize lower costs by choosing midweek or off-peak weddings.
3. Venue Selection & Key Influences
65% of couples host the ceremony and reception at the same venue, making all-in-one options attractive.
Location (78%), value (76%), and food quality (74%) are the top three factors influencing venue choices.
54% found nothing particularly memorable when inquiring with venues, highlighting an opportunity to improve first impressions.
4. Importance of Pricing Transparency
30% of couples won’t inquire if prices aren’t listed online.
Hidden costs frustrate couples, and clear, upfront pricing can increase quality leads.
5. Communication & Booking Process
60% inquire with five or fewer venues, so standing out early is crucial.
Nearly a third expect a response within 48 hours, with slow replies being a major frustration.
61% want brochures immediately via email rather than waiting for a physical copy.
Couples prefer email as the main communication channel, with WhatsApp and phone calls becoming relevant later.
6. Marketing & Social Media
62% use Instagram for wedding inspiration, making it the top social platform.
TikTok is growing in influence, while wedding blogs and magazines are losing traction.
Couples prefer real weddings, tips, and behind-the-scenes content over influencer endorsements.
7. Sustainability Matters
70% of couples consider sustainability in wedding planning.
E-vites, upcycled décor, and eco-friendly confetti are among the top green choices.
8. The Rise of AI & Technology
6% of couples are using AI for wedding planning, including invitation wording and vendor searches.
72% watch virtual venue tours before inquiring, making high-quality visuals essential.
9. Common Planning Challenges
Budgeting, finding the right venue, and family expectations are the biggest stressors.
Many feel like just another number during inquiries, meaning personalization is key.
10. How to Win More Bookings
Personalize responses and avoid robotic emails.
Highlight bridal rooms and exclusive-use options to appeal to modern couples.
Offer flexible payment plans and all-inclusive packages.
Ensure quick follow-ups and seamless communication to build trust.
Emphasize quality and value rather than just price.
Thoughts
As we move through 2025, one thing is clear: today’s couples are looking for more than just a wedding—they want an experience that feels uniquely theirs. They’re prioritizing value, transparency, and personalization while navigating tighter budgets and rising costs.
For wedding vendors, this means adapting to meet couples where they are. Quick, friendly communication, clear pricing, and flexible offerings will help you stand out. Social media—especially Instagram and TikTok—continues to be a powerful tool for inspiration and connection, making high-quality visuals and behind-the-scenes content essential.
Couples also want to feel seen and heard. Whether it’s responding to inquiries faster, offering customizable packages, or simply making them feel special, small gestures can lead to big bookings. The vendors who take the time to build relationships, educate their clients, and create stress-free experiences will be the ones securing more weddings.
The U.S. wedding market may differ from the UK in trends and traditions, but the fundamentals remain the same: couples crave authenticity, trust, and seamless service. By staying ahead of their needs and fine-tuning your approach, you'll be ready to turn more inquiries into celebrations.
